#6e0028 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e0028 is composed of 43.1% red, 0%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 63.6%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 338.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 21.6%. #6e0028 color hex could be obtained by blending #dc0050 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#6e0028 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e0028 has RGB values of R:110, G:0,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.64,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 7209000.

Shades and Tints of #6e0028
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0004 is the darkest color, while #fff7fa is the lightest one.
